Data readiness terms
These words describe data quality and coverage — not billing, plans, or payments. Product copy, badges, and Setup cards reuse the same vocabulary so similar states do not contradict each other.
Glossary
- Ready
- Core sources succeeded for this window — charts and KPIs reflect synced data, not forecasts.
- Fresh
- Data reflects a recent successful load for the sources behind this view — still sanity-check when stakes are high.
- Stale
- Last successful loads are older than we expect for day-to-day decisions — refresh sync before trusting momentum.
- Partial / partial read
- Some expected signals are missing or still updating — use directionally, not as a complete picture.
- Failed sync
- A source sync failed — KPIs may be wrong or empty until you fix the source and retry.
- Unavailable
- Not enough loaded data yet to treat this surface as a trustworthy read.
- Setup incomplete
- A required source is not configured or connected — finish Setup; this is expected until you wire sources.
- Insufficient evidence (Insights benchmarks)
- Not enough benchmark-grade evidence to support automated comparisons — broader product data may still load elsewhere.
Where this shows up
- Overview hero badges and the short health line under your game title.
- The Sources and freshness table (Data for this view).
- Setup source cards — headlines and compact status badges.
- Insights overview shell badge (benchmark-grade signal, separate from billing gates).
- Today KPI sublines when the day slice is incomplete or stale.
Sidebar layout for new workspaces
Until KPI read-model data exists for your selected game, the left nav groups Core path (Overview, Revenue, Wishlists, Reviews, Refunds) ahead of More tools (Insights, Reports, Creative, Steam News). After the first evidence loads, the full flat list returns automatically so nothing stays hidden for entitled users.
